Let’s review the use cases of OCR technology:
Banking Industry
Financial institutions widely use OCR applications for their regular administrative tasks due to the excessive paperwork.
OCR facilitates daily operational tasks for banks to a great extent easing the banking procedures. The ATMs are one of the applications that serve billions of people daily by extracting the data on the ATM card. It also helps bank officers to scan handwritten cheques and manage the data digitally.
Healthcare Industry
Hospitals and other healthcare providers have to deal with heaps of paperwork like patient test reports, insurance forms and many more. It is not easy for them to maintain bulk records.
OCR technology helps the healthcare sector to digitize large volumes of data including patient profiles, treatment history, health insurance details, etc. to reduce manual work and keep the patients’ data safe from fraudsters. Digitizing patient’s data with the help of an OCR scanner helps physicians to diagnose patients by reviewing their previous medical records for better treatment.

Benefits of OCR technology
The following are some benefits that OCR technology brings to businesses:
Reduced Manual Identification
OCR screening proves to be a helping hand for businesses to know their customer compliance.
Whenever a customer needs to confirm his identity, he has to send a valid ID document comprising his details. The character reader fetches the required information that is sufficient to match the customer’s details and sends it to the automated system. The automated system verifies the details of the customer and forwards the results to the back office with proof of verification.
Automated data entry operations
Business operations including the collection of customer information can employ OCR technology to feed the identity document to the system and extract all the customer information from the very same document in seconds.

Reduced Error-rate
Businesses can reduce errors which appear due to manual data entry. AI-powered OCR systems can extract the user information while rectifying such errors.
Reduced Time and Cost
AI-powered OCR solutions accurately extract data from structured documents that follow a standard template such as government-issued documents like passports, licenses, etc. It can also extract data from unstructured documents that do not follow any standard format such as images, PDF formats, handwritten documents, etc. to facilitate the administrative tasks for companies.
The ability of OCR scanners to fetch data from various documents helps businesses to save time and cost by reducing manual labor.
